Bridging Military Leadership and Academic Excellence

Academy professors serve as military and academic leaders within their respective departments. Academy professors are a critical link between the senior academic leaders at West Point and the remainder of faculty and staff. 

Interested personnel can read more about the requirements of the role of Functional Area 47 officers in DA Pam 600-3. Applicants must have a strong commitment to the educational, military, physical, and ethical development of cadets. Dedication to excellence in teaching is an absolute requirement.

Explore Direct Hire Opportunities

Officers with an existing master's degree or Ph.D. in a relevant field are occasionally assigned to the USMA faculty without the need to attend additional schooling. This is done by exception to fill unforecasted personnel shortfalls.
